"Half-Life 2 delayed" says Shacknews
 
According to Shacknews, Doug Lombardi has confirmed hat Half-Life 2 is being pushed back for the holidays:

Quote:

Originally Posted by Doug Lombardi
The previously announced September 30th release date for Half-Life 2 is being pushed back. We are currently targeting a holiday release, but do not have a specific "in-store" date to share at this time. We will release that information as soon as we have confirmed a new date.

Quote:

23:00 24 September 2003
PC News

Gabe Newell let us know that the 'news' posted on Shacknews yesterday (story) is a fake and that Half-Life 2 has gone Gold and in production now. Here's the official word: "The release will still remain on schedule for Sep 30th. People who have pre-orded it via Steam will still get it before the Sep 30th but we are currently ironing out a couple of bugs, people may have seen Half Life 2 yesterday for a minute on it while we were in our testing stages (...) The SDK will be available for download tomorrow 2.00pm EST. Now you've heard it from the horses mouth so rest assured. More news to follow on Sep 26th so watch this space."

Half Life 2 has gone Gold and in production now, the release will still remain on schedule for Sep 30th. People who have pre-orded it via Steam will still get it before the Sep 30th but we are currently ironing out a couple of bugs, people may have seen Half Life 2 yesterday for a minute on it while we were in our testing stages.

full story, Gamer's Hell

amishler 09-24-2003 12:59 PM

Because I never met a parade I couldn't rain on...

Quote:

Update: After a few phone conversations with VU and thorough investigation of e-mail headers, coupled with the knowledge that Valve isn't located in UK (e-mail header), we've decided to have fallen victims to an e-mail spoof (although Valve is still unavailable to comment). While VU PR representative was unable to comment on actual release date, we feel stronger than not that the game has indeed been delayed.
